How To Fix DA434 - Matchcode conversion from pool -> View (unexpected TBATG request)


DA434 - Overview

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: DA - Dictionary: Compare, distribution, timer, instantiation

  • Message number: 434

  • Message text: Matchcode conversion from pool -> View (unexpected TBATG request)

    The SAP error message DA434, which states "Matchcode conversion from pool -> View (unexpected TBATG request)," typically occurs in the context of using matchcodes (also known as search helps) in SAP. This error can arise when there is an issue with the conversion of a matchcode from a pool to a view, often related to the underlying data or configuration.
    
    Cause: Data Inconsistency: There may be inconsistencies in the data that the matchcode is trying to access, such as missing or corrupted entries.
    Configuration Issues: The matchcode or search help may not be properly configured, leading to unexpected requests. Database Issues: There could be issues with the database that prevent the matchcode from functioning correctly. Transport Issues: If the matchcode was transported from one system to another, there may be missing dependencies or configuration settings.
